Mason City man jailed on 3rd OWI and child endangerment charges

NORA SPRINGS – Shortly after 4pm on Wednesday a Cerro Gordo County Sheriff’s deputy made traffic stop west of Nora Springs near the corner of HWY 18 and 265th street.

As a result of that stop Jeffery Collins, age 28, of Mason City was arrested for 3rd Offense OWI, one count of child endangerment, speeding, and not having a drivers license.

Collins was transported to the Cerro Gordo County jail where he is currently being held on a $5000 cash or surety bond pending further court proceedings.

3rd Offense OWI is a class D felony punishable by up to 5 years in prison and a $7500 fine if convicted. Child endangerment is an aggravated misdemeanor punishable by up to two years in prison if convicted. Law enforcement is mandated to notify DHS to follow up to ensure continued safety of the child.

According to a study by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) found that 2,335 children were killed in drunk driving accidents between 1997 and 2002. Of those children who were killed, 68 percent of them were in a vehicle driven by an impaired driver.
